Assign STEM Connect Lessons
Each lesson is assignable to students. This provides quick access for students from their My DE homepage.
There are two ways to assign lessons:
- From the unit page, select the three ellipses, select Assign, and assign the content to a class, classes, or to individual students.
- With the lesson open, click the assign icon above the slideshow.
Throughout STEM Connect lessons, you may find embedded response modules which, when assigned, allow students to respond directly in the lesson.
To learn more on how to view student responses and grades in these types of lesson, explore assigning Studio resources.
Assign Individual Content Connections or STEM Careers
In addition to lessons, you can also choose to assign a single content connection, hands-on activity, or STEM Career video.
To assign a resource, look for the Assign option. Depending on the location of the resource, you may see an ellipsis (...) or an Assign button. Select Assign and assign the content to a class, classes, or to individual students.
Assign Options
When content is assigned to students, the following options are available:
- Step 1 - name the assignment and give directions for students
- Step 2 - select the date you want content to appear on student learning plans as well as the date for when content or work should be completed by
- Step 3 - select the class (or grouping of students) to which something should be assigned
- Step 4 - confirm the settings of your assignment and click okay
